    This is all ok, until sometimes the server stop responding correcly for requests regarding this two pages with the Applet.
    When this happens the server just responds with a blank page.
    - with fiddler I can seer the request for the aspx page (that uses the applet)
    - but server responds with a blank html pageWell, if http requests look identical in case of success and failure (pay attention to cookies, etc) then it has to be something on the server side.
    It could be that server gets into this wrong state because of previous requests made by applet but it is hard to tell.
    I am not clear how old/new plugin can make a difference unless your applets run in the legacy mode (i.e. you are actually trying to reuse SAME instance of the applet when
    it is loaded next time).
    I'd start with
    1) carefully comparing good/bad sessions
    2) checking whether server will serve correct response to another client when it serves "bad" page for current client
    3) add debug statements to aspx - it is scripted page, may be some condition is not met and then it returns blank?
    4) record all http requests in one session until you get to "error" state and then use any http server testing tool to "replay" this set of requests.
    You should be able to get server into the same state without use of applet. Then you can try to tweak set of requests to see what makes a difference.

  • Webkit. How to connect external javascript from dir C:

    I can't execute javascript from dir C:
    I have some html, that I load in Webkit with loadContent(). In that html invoked function test(). Function contains in a separate javascript file.
    <head>     
    <script language='javascript' type='text/javascript' src="file:///C:/temp/test.js"></script>
    <script>
         function getText() { var val = document.getElementById('text_area').value;
              prompt('getText', "val");
    </script>          
    </head>
    <body>
           <textarea id='text_area' name='text_area' style="width:100%; height:100%"></textarea>     
           <script> test(); </script>
    </body>External javascript (test.js)
    function test() {
            alert('It works!');
         getText();           
    }External js doesn't work. PromptHandler (AlertHandler) doesn't catch anything. If I use wEngine.executeScript('test'), appear error: netscape.javascript.JSException: ReferenceError: Can't find variable: getText.
    But that code works on any other browsers.

    Thank you for the problem report!
    This looks like a bug in WebView. A Jira issue has been filed to track this: http://javafx-jira.kenai.com/browse/RT-17330. Note that the issue may end up classified as not-a-bug because the ability to run local scripts from dynamic contents may be considered a security hole.
    As a workaround, try saving your HTML into a temporary file and load it using WebEngine.load(). It should work as in any other browser. Another option is to include all necessary code in the HTML document loaded with WebEngine.loadContent(), but I gather that is undesirable in your case.
